It’s all very complicated so I’ll just copy-paste the whole thing: “ 11 AS IN ADVERSARIES are here to flip the script and destroy the norm. Existing in a stratosphere where rules no longer apply, 11 AS IN ADVERSARIES features the mastermind of extreme-metal rule-breakers GLORIOR BELLI and fittingly combines dark, moody post-punk with the most avant-garde ends of extreme metal. Utterly twisted yet surprisingly melodic, contorting and slithering like a snake, the band's ‘The Full Intrepid Experience of Light’ seeks its own truth, its own light in the darkness, vast and epic yet brave and unselfconscious.” Press release further on suggests we should “absorb the album and be forever altered”. If so inclined, click here (official MySpace) and live with the consequences, heh. 11 AS IN ADVERSARIES' debut album was released yesterday, November 15th, 2010 (15. 11. 2010) through ATMF (Aeternitas Tenebrarum Music Foundation).

11 AS IN ADVERSARIES is a metal/rock/psyche project that aims to offer an alternative outlet for occasionally limited artists. The band was formed in early 2010 by J. (guitar/bass/vocals) and G. (drums). With some help from Niklas Kvarforth (from Sweden's SHINING), the ADVERSARIES  messed around with extreme metal and indie tunes in order to mix-together “a massively demented debut album” – their words not mine. And there is more; the meaning of their name “lies within a numerological context where 11 stands for what is beyond 10”. Heh. Explanation: “Numbers 1 to 10 are representative of the law & order and cosmic completion. 11 is a manifestation of freedom and rebellion for its magic can bring one to defy the limitations imposed by the Demiurge.” (“Demiurge” probably being the originator of evil or perhaps represents the public official, heh.) And since there are eleven letters in the word “adversaries”, we get to call the band “11 AS IN ADVERSARIES”.
